About this spot
Lumsdale is a hidden valley tucked away between Matlock and Tansley. Bentley
Brook is the heart of the dale. The gushing stream rushes down, past abandoned
Arkwright Mills, cascading over many drops. This creates some of the most impressive waterfalls within Derbyshire and the Peak District. This area is a real hidden gem with four distinct waterfalls.

The area is picturesque, it is a deep wooded gorge, lined with stone ruins, Arkwright buildings, waterfalls, a mill pond and water wheels. The area is now protected by the Arkwright Society to preserve this unique mixture of industrial heritage and natural beauty.
